         U.S. SENATE HEALTH AND FITNESS FACILITIES REGULATIONS

  Mr. McCONNELL. Mr. President, pursuant to Senate Rule XXXIII, the 
Committee on Rules and Administration adopted the U.S. Senate Health 
and Fitness Facilities Regulations, on May 6, 2025, which supersede and 
replace the current ``Guidelines for Senate Tennis Courts,'' 
``Regulations for the Senate Health Facility in the Office of the 
Architect of the Capitol,'' and ``Regulations Governing Use of the 
Senate Health and Fitness Facility.''
  The updated regulations consolidate rules for the use of the fitness 
facilities, including the Senators' gym, staff gym, and athletic 
courts. The updated regulations define eligible staff for membership 
purposes and reflect current operational practices.

         U.S. Senate Health and Fitness Facilities Regulations

 [Adopted by the Committee on Rules and Administration on May 6, 2025, 
      pursuant to rule XXXIII of the Standing Rules of the Senate]

       1.0 Scope--The United States Senate offers the use of 
     health and fitness facilities within the Senate office 
     buildings to Senators and staff. These regulations establish 
     the policies, procedures, and management responsibilities for 
     these facilities.
       2.0 Definitions--For purposes of these regulations, the 
     following terms shall have the meaning specified.
       2.1 AOC means the Architect of the Capitol.
       2.2 Athletic courts means the multi-sport courts located in 
     the Dirksen Senate Office Building.
       2.3 Disbursing Office means the Secretary of the Senate's 
     Disbursing Office.
       2.4 Eligible senator means a U.S. Senator.
       2.5 Eligible staff means an employee of the Senate, 
     employee of the Superintendent's Office, a Senate detailee or 
     paid fellow whose contract duration is greater than or equal 
     to six months, or an employee of a federal government agency 
     liaison office housed within Senate space. Interns, clerks, 
     unpaid fellows, members of the media, and other non-
     government employees that provide services to the Senate are 
     not covered under this term.
       2.6 Fitness facilities means the U.S. Senate Health and 
     Fitness Facilities, including the Senators' gym, staff gym, 
     athletic courts, and all the associated equipment, 
     furnishings, and fixtures.
       2.7 Membership means the ongoing state of being qualified 
     to use the fitness facilities by meeting the criteria to be 
     an eligible senator or staffer and paying the required 
     membership fee.
       2.8 Membership fee means the monthly or annual payment made 
     to maintain a fitness facilities membership.
       2.9 Rules Committee means the U.S. Senate Committee on 
     Rules and Administration.
       2.10 Senators' gym means the gym located in the Russell 
     Senate Office Building.
       2.11 Superintendent's Office means the Architect of the 
     Capitol's Senate Superintendent Office.
       2.12 Staff gym means the gym located in the Dirksen Senate 
     Office Building.
       2.13 Support office means the office of an internal 
     congressional entity that provides services to the U.S. 
     Senate including but not limited to, the Architect of the 
     Capitol, the Sergeant at Arms and Doorkeeper of the Senate, 
     the Secretary of the Senate, and the United States Capitol 
     Police.
       3.0 General Information--The AOC shall supervise and manage 
     the fitness facilities

[[Page S2859]]

     subject to rules, regulations, policies, and fee structures 
     approved by the Rules Committee.
       3.1 The Senators' gym is reserved only for use by eligible 
     senators with memberships. No guests of any sort are 
     permitted.
       3.2 The staff gym is reserved only for use by eligible 
     staff with memberships. No guests of any sort are permitted.
       3.3 The athletic courts are reserved only for use by 
     eligible senators with memberships to the Senators' gym, 
     their current Chiefs of Staff and/or Staff Directors with 
     memberships to the staff gym, and support office programs 
     approved by the Rules Committee. Guests are permitted 
     pursuant to section 5.4.
       3.4 No photography, filming, live streaming, or media 
     related activities are permitted in the fitness facilities.
       3.5 No food or event setup is permitted in the fitness 
     facilities.
       3.6 The maximum occupancy for the courts is determined by 
     the AOC Fire Marshal and shall not be exceeded.
       Membership--Prior to using a fitness facility, eligible 
     senators and staff shall fill out a membership application to 
     their respective fitness facility, which must be approved or 
     denied by the AOC.
       4.1 If an eligible senator's membership is approved by the 
     AOC, the senator shall pay a monthly or annual membership fee 
     through the Disbursing Office.
       4.1.1 The Disbursing Office shall provide monthly the list 
     of senators paying a membership fee to the AOC.
       4.2 If an eligible staffer's membership is approved by the 
     AOC, the staffer shall pay a monthly membership fee through 
     the AOC.
       4.3 Memberships are continuous until the eligible senator 
     or staff cancels the membership or no longer meets the 
     criteria for membership.
       4.4 A membership may be revoked by the AOC in cases of 
     noncompliance with fitness facilities policies.
        Athletic Court Reservations--Reservations are required to 
     use the athletics courts.
       5.1 Reservations shall be made through the AOC no more than 
     one month in advance.
       5.2 Reservations are first come, first served, and can be 
     no more than two hours in length.
       5.3 Senator reservations have priority and shall supersede 
     the reservations of Chiefs of Staff and Staff Directors if 
     the same reservation time period is requested.
       5.4 Reservations may include guests without memberships, so 
     long as the reservation holder is present for the entire 
     duration of the reservation.
